If these are email scams, report to the government website.

[email protected]

Its from this website https://www.gov.uk/report-suspicious-emails-websites-phishing

You just forward the offending email to them at report@phishing.gov.uk

It can’t help you, if you’ve clicked on links, but might help getting the perpetrators stopped.

This is a subscription scam, if you do not contact them within 3 days they will take more money from your account, what for it doesn’t say. If it is not cancelled then you should contact your bank immediately. This advice was from my Credit Card Company
